Follow this Fallout 2 guide to navigate Gecko, obtain keycards from the Nuclear Plant, and find the missing Woody in the Junkyard.
Walkthrough
- 1Enter Gecko and go to the building labeled "manager's office."
- 2Examine the desk to find two clipboards.
- 3Examine the shelf in the left hall to find a book about science.
- 4Talk to Harold, the ghoul in the primary room next to the desk. Ask him what he does, and he will mention the reactor is not working well and he needs a Hydroelectric Magnetosphere.
- 5Talk to Lenny, the ghoul to Harold's left, to recruit him as an NPC. He can also heal you.
- 6Head east to the Nuclear Plant.
- 7Navigate north and east within the plant to find a room with a ghoul behind lockers.
- 8Talk to the ghoul (shaved head) and tell him you have something to pick up.
- 9Ask for a three-step plasma transformer and give him the part request form from the clipboard.
- 10Leave the room and go east to a room with a rusted locker.
- 11Open the locker and take the yellow keycard.
- 12Head to the southern part of the reactor. Use the yellow keycard to open the yellow door.
- 13Go to the room with a shelf, examine it, and take the red keycard.
- 14Replace the yellow keycard with the red keycard in your item slot.
- 15Go east and talk to Festus, the ghoul in the southeasternmost room.
- 16Tell Festus the reactor isn't running well and that Vault City is complaining about groundwater. He will dismiss your concerns.
- 17Leave the reactor and go to the Junkyard to the north.
- 18Go to the Survival Gear center and talk to the shopkeeper.
- 19Ask what's happening, and he will mention his friend Woody is missing. Offer to find Woody.
- 20Go to the northwest and enter the large building.
- 21Talk to the ghoul there, who offers to fix one of your weapons in exchange for finding a three-step plasma transformer. You can upgrade a .44 Magnum speed loader or an assault rifle ammo magazine.
- 22After getting your weapon upgrade, leave for Vault City.
NPC Information:
- Lenny: With 129 HP, he is durable. His forte is the Doctor skill, allowing him to heal you. He can use SMGs and pistols, performing best with an H&K G11/G11E or the .223 Pistol. He is not considered a top-tier NPC for the long run.
Tips
- The science book found in the manager's office can be used to increase your Science skill.
- The speed loader for the .44 Magnum or the ammo magazine upgrade for the assault rifle are good options for weapon enhancement.
